If you’ve ever wondered what is prop money, it’s realistic-looking replica currency designed specifically for creative, educational, and entertainment purposes. Unlike real money, prop money is completely legal and safe to use, making it ideal for films, videos, photography, theatrical performances, and even training exercises. Its main function is to simulate real cash transactions without any legal or safety concerns.
Understanding what is prop money is crucial for filmmakers. High-quality prop bills are produced with lifelike textures, accurate colors, and detailed printing, making them look convincing on camera. Directors and actors can handle these bills naturally in scenes involving bank transactions, heists, or everyday money interactions. By using prop money, productions can maintain authenticity while remaining fully compliant with the law, ensuring a safe environment for everyone on set.
Photographers and content creators also benefit from knowing what is prop money. It can be used in lifestyle photography, social media content, or promotional shoots to add realism and storytelling depth. Prop bills allow photographers to stage money-related scenes without the risks and inconvenience of handling real cash.
Educators and trainers frequently use prop money for teaching cash-handling skills, counting exercises, and financial literacy in classrooms or workshops. Its realistic design makes lessons more interactive and engaging while keeping everything safe and legal.
